What is a judgment based on reasoning from evidence is an called?

A judgment based on reasoning from evidence is called an inference. Inferences involve drawing conclusions or making predictions based on available information, observations, or data. This process allows individuals to interpret and understand situations beyond the immediate evidence presented. Inferences are crucial in critical thinking, scientific reasoning, and everyday decision-making.
